Hello,

I'm running 2.4.10 on a SMP box with 4G of memory; I've  installed
the patch to let a process use up to 3.5 GB and I set highmem 4G.
I was using NFS to get remote files and copy them (using cpio) to the
local filesystem (SCSI drive).
After a while I started getting the following errors and the processes died.
